The 92210 ZIP Code is centered1 in Riverside County at latitude 33.716 and longitude -116.334. It is a standard type ZIP Code. Riverside County is in the Pacific Time Zone (UTC -8 hours) and observes daylight savings time.

The population in ZIP Code Tabulation Area (ZCTA) 92210 was 3,859 with 3,885 housing units; a land area land area of 204.41 sq. miles; a water area of 0 sq. miles; and a population density of 18.88 people per sq. mile for Census 2000. Demographic Profile
